Transaction ef4c63d47663fbfaba15821e3d70bfadeebef470d7a5a6cdc82dbfc95956cd79
2 Input
2 Outputs
- ef4c63d47663fbfaba15821e3d70bfadeebef470d7a5a6cdc82dbfc95956cd79:0
- ef4c63d47663fbfaba15821e3d70bfadeebef470d7a5a6cdc82dbfc95956cd79:1
value 1607178
address 1DFkqbGpTUcKuWtybjdtgrcumDs6UQmMaG
value 44397839
address 12vYMTvHaV8dAc1k3oHVy9QdD4Ahx8Bhoz